Overview
The EBX-2163 is the DCM (door / window control module) in the EBX family's shared 125 × 123.9 mm cab-side controller platform. The platform groups three controllers on the same housing / mounting footprint / four-fold safety protection silicon stack, with the connector configuration and the firmware function-block selecting the module's purpose:
- EBX-2162 — WCM (wiper control). 30-pin Tyco connector pair, wiper / washer / LIN output / steering-wheel multi-function pass-through.
- EBX-2163 — this module — DCM (door / window / mirror / lock control). 44-pin TE connector pair, window drive + mirror adjust & heat + central-locking + RKE remote with key learning + external RF antenna input.
- EBX-2164 — LCM (lighting control). 50-pin TE connector pair, full vehicle lighting + trailer-light detection + ADAS-input pass-through.
For a commercial-vehicle program that wants to standardise the cab-side controllers on one housing / one mounting footprint / one toolchain, the platform approach lets the program order any combination of WCM / DCM / LCM and have them install on the same bracket with the same fixings.
Integrated functions (4 main groups)
1. Main & passenger window drive
Up / down drive on the main-side window and the passenger-side window. Both driver-side switch inputs (4 channels: main-up / main-down / passenger-up / passenger-down) and master-side cross-control (master switch can lift / lower the passenger-side window).
2. Mirror adjust + mirror heat
Four-axis mirror adjust (up / down / left / right) on both the left and the right mirror, with mirror-selector switching (left / right select input) so a single 4-axis joystick switch can address both mirrors. Mirror heat drive (one shared mirror-heat output channel) for cold-weather defog / de-ice.
3. Central locking with mechanical-key + RKE remote + key learning
Central lock / unlock drive on both doors, with the multi-source command set: mechanical-key (from the lock barrel feedback), RKE remote (from the smart-key fob via the external RF antenna), central-lock dashboard switch, and the door-lock feedback loop. Key-learning function lets the program pair a new RKE fob without an external tool — per the programme's key-management policy.
4. Network function (1 × CAN @ 250 kbps + LIN reserved)
1 × high-speed CAN bus @ 250 kbps to the body backbone (CAN protocol confirmed per program; J1939 family typical for 24 V commercial-vehicle programs). The DCM publishes the door-state / lock-state / window-state to the backbone and subscribes to the central-lock command and the cabin-state messages. 1 × LIN port is reserved on the standard build for downstream LIN-side accessories.
Engineering details
The EBX-2163 sits on the shared 125 × 123.9 × 28.6 mm platform housing — same dimensions / same mounting features as the EBX-2162 WCM and the EBX-2164 LCM. The connector configuration is different (44-pin TE pair instead of the WCM's 30-pin Tyco pair), but the mounting footprint and the housing tooling are shared.
- Four-fold safety protection — over-voltage, over-current, short-circuit and over-temperature protection on each high-current drive channel; particularly important on the window-motor and lock-motor drives where stall current and jam-detect are routine events
- External RF antenna input on the 24-pin connector — lets the OEM route the RKE receive antenna up to the dashboard or A-pillar (where the LOS to the fob is best) without forcing the DCM itself to be mounted in a specific position
- 44-pin TE dual-connector — harness designer lands the high-current drive side on the 20-pin output connector and the input / sensor / RF / CAN side on the 24-pin input connector; clean separation between the high-current and the signal sides at the harness end
- Two power-supply rails on the drive side: one rail powers the window-motor and the lock-motor drive (pin 10 on the 20-pin output connector), the other powers the mirror-adjust and HSD-reserved outputs (pin 20) — lets the integrator size and protect the two rails independently
- Mirror-selector pattern: the 24-pin input connector carries dedicated left-mirror-select and right-mirror-select inputs, so a single 4-axis joystick switch addresses both mirrors via switch-side selection (saves harness pins vs. running 4-axis switches per mirror)
- Key-learning function on the standard build — the program can pair a new RKE fob via the controller's learning sequence without needing an external diagnostic tool
- Free-orientation mounting on the shared platform housing
- IP53 sealing class suitable for in-cab installation

Manufacturing & testing
Built under IATF 16949 with APQP project planning and a PPAP package available for OEM programmes. Every unit is end-of-line functional-tested before packaging — the main / passenger window drive on both up and down, the 4-axis mirror-adjust drive on both mirrors with the mirror-selector input, the mirror-heat drive, the central-lock / unlock drive with the door-state feedback loop, the external RF antenna input on the receive side with a paired RKE fob, the key-learning sequence, the 250 kbps CAN bus health and the four-fold safety-protection envelope (over-voltage / over-current / short-circuit / over-temperature trip and recovery) are all checked.
